The Cheer Ambassadors chronicles the Thai National Cheerleading Team's inspiring story of a coach and his team as they travel from the city streets and rice fields in Thailand to the World Championship in Orlando, Florida. The Cheer Ambassadors is a feature-length documentary about an incredible team of athletes in Thailand and their journey: from one man's dream to the day when they competed in the world cheerleading championships and caused 10,000 spectators to jump up and down screaming